Frame Repairs

Over time, sun, wind and rain will cause damage to your window frames. If they are not properly maintained it could cause rot and mold as well as water leaks, air leaks, and other expensive damages. Fortunately, experts in home improvement can fix many of these issues, assisting you save money and have your home more comfortably.

The cost of fixing your frames depends on a number of factors, such as the size of the frame and the material used. In general you can expect to pay between $250 and $500 for each window, but it could be possible to fix some frames at a lower cost. Some companies offer package prices that reduce overall costs, while others charge per hour for labor and materials.

If you have wood frames, the most common issue is rot or mold. Contact a professional in home improvement when you observe any of these signs to avoid further damage. Professionals can repair damaged areas of the frame, reseal your windows, and install new weather stripping. This will ensure that your home is sealed and help you reduce energy costs.

Air drafts can also be caused by a frail frame, which can be a real pain in hot or cold weather. These drafts are often caused by a broken caulk seal or poorly fitted window. These issues can be fixed by experts to increase energy efficiency and make your home more comfortable throughout the year.

Repairs can be easy or more complex based on the type and position of the frame. If the wooden frame of your window has begun to decay, you might need to replace the frame. Likewise, if a window has become misaligned due to settling, it'll require resealing and the sill repositioned.

With a few simple tools, and a steady touch you can easily adjust the majority of bent frames of metal. For instance, you can make use of a pair of soft-tipped pliers to gently bend metal window frames without breaking them. However, it's a good idea to call an expert for assistance if you're not sure what tools or materials are needed for the job. You might damage your window frame, or even harm it if you try this at home. A professional will have an able hand and the appropriate tools for the job. They will also know the methods to employ to ensure that your glass is not damaged or frames. They'll also be able to tackle delicate tasks, such as the restoration of old windows. They can also repair sash cords and tighten cames. They can help you avoid having to replace your windows altogether.

Repair of Stained Glass

Many stained glass window, old and new, require some repairs or restorations to ensure they are in good condition. It is crucial to get them repaired as soon as possible because if the window is not maintained in good condition, it can cause irreparable damage, rendering the window inoperable. Various types of repairs can be done to a stained or leaded glass window, from filling cracks with silicone, to releading and tightening cames. The cost of stained-glass repair is contingent on the severity of damage and the work required to repair it. A professional who is familiar with stained or leaded glass will examine the window in detail before making an estimate of the cost of restoration or repair.

One of the most common reasons to need repair to stained glass is chipped or broken glass. It could be due to mishandling or simply wear and tear. Glass may also have to be replaced if it is seriously damaged. Fading colors is another common problem with stained or lead glass. Glass may fade over time due to exposure to sunlight or changing weather conditions. A professional can re-stack the glass in order to restore its original appearance and color.

The typical cost for repair of stained glass is about $500. This includes cleaning, repairing and filling cracks using silicone tightening or releading the cames, as well as any other necessary repairs for a 12-by-24-inch window. The cost of restoring a stained glass window to its original condition can be as high as $10,000 depending on how badly damaged it is and the amount of work needed.

Cement, often referred to as glazier's putty, can be used to fix the window panes and lead cames of stained glass windows. As time passes the cement may become brittle and damaged. It must be replaced. This is a simple job for most reputable stained glass specialists, however it's not uncommon to have it included in the larger repair or restoration project.

It is also necessary to replace reinforcement bars in stained glass windows. These are specially designed support structures that are anchored to the frame or jamb of windows and aid in preventing bulging and sagging. The cost of replacing these bars may differ depending on the size and number of windows that need to be replaced.

It is essential to keep stained and leaded glasses as they are fragile. The right cleaning products will help them last for as long as possible. Use a mild dishwashing soap and warm water to clean your dishes frequently. Cleaning should be done with care to prevent any damage.
